3 Timer Init Timer Clock Enable 3 void TMR0_Init(void) { CLK_EnableModuleClock(TMR0_MODULE); CLK_SetModuleClock(TMR0_MODULE, CLK_CLKSEL1_TMR0_S_HIRC, 4); }

4 Timer Delay Test Delay 함수 제작 Time-out period = (Period time of timer clock input) * (8-bit pre-scale counter + 1) * (24-bit TCMP) Timer 1ms Period Value = System Clock / (pre-scale + 1) / 1000 System Clock : 22,118,400 Hz 4

5 Timer Delay Test 5 int delay(int ms) { int prescaler =3; TIMER0->TCSR &=~(0xFF); TIMER0->TCSR |= prescaler; // Set Prescaler : 1ms period TIMER0->TCMPR = ms * (SystemCoreClock / (prescaler + 1)) / 1000; //printf("Timer Register TCSR = 0x%x\n", TIMER0->TCSR); //printf("Timer Register TCMPR = %d\n", TIMER0->TCMPR); TIMER0->TCSR &= ~(0x3 << 27) ; // One shot Mode TIMER0->TCSR |= (0x1 << 30 ); // Start Counting; while(TIMER0->TCSR & TIMER_TCSR_CACT_Msk); }

6 Timer Interrupt Test Timer Handler 6 void TMR0_IRQHandler(void) { /* Clears Timer time-out interrupt flag */ TIMER_ClearIntFlag(TIMER0); Count++; P2->DOUT &= ~0x7; if(Count > 0x7) { Count = 0x0; } P2->DOUT |= Count; }

7 Timer Interrupt Test One Shot Mode 7 void TMR0_Init(void) { CLK_EnableModuleClock(TMR0_MODULE); CLK_SetModuleClock(TMR0_MODULE, CLK_CLKSEL1_TMR0_S_HIRC, 4); TIMER_Open(TIMER0, TIMER_ONESHOT_MODE, 1); /* Enable the Timer time-out interrupt */ TIMER_EnableInt(TIMER0); /* Start Timer counting */ TIMER_Start(TIMER0); /* Enable TMR0 Interrupt */ NVIC_EnableIRQ(TMR0_IRQn); }

8 Timer Interrupt Test Periodic Mode 8 void TMR0_Init(void) { CLK_EnableModuleClock(TMR0_MODULE); CLK_SetModuleClock(TMR0_MODULE, CLK_CLKSEL1_TMR0_S_HIRC, 4); TIMER_Open(TIMER0, TIMER_PERIODIC_MODE, 1); /* Enable the Timer time-out interrupt */ TIMER_EnableInt(TIMER0); /* Start Timer counting */ TIMER_Start(TIMER0); /* Enable TMR0 Interrupt */ NVIC_EnableIRQ(TMR0_IRQn); }

9 Watch Dog Test Init 9 void WDT_Init(void) { SYS_UnlockReg(); CLK_EnableModuleClock(WDT_MODULE); CLK_SetModuleClock(WDT_MODULE, CLK_CLKSEL1_WDT_S_HCLK_DIV2048, 1); WDT->WTCR &= ~(0x7 << 8); WDT->WTCR |= (0x6 << 8); WDT->WTCR |= 0x3 << 6; WDT->WTCR |= 0x1 << 1; NVIC_EnableIRQ(WDT_IRQn); SYS_LockReg(); }

10 Watch Dog Test Watch Dog Handler 10 void WDT_IRQHandler(void) { WDT_CLEAR_TIMEOUT_INT_FLAG(); printf("WDT_Interrupt!!\n"); WDT->WTCR |= 0x1; // Reset WDT Counter }

11 Watch Dog Test Watch Dog Counter Clear 11 void WDT_Clear(void) { SYS_UnlockReg(); WDT->WTCR |= 0x1; SYS_LockReg(); }

12 Watch Dog Test Watch Dog Counter Clear (main) 12 int main(void) { int count = 0; SYS_Init(); … while(1) { … WDT_Clear(); }
